Car Accessories in Athens, TN
31. D & H Auto Glass
1402 Jones Ave SW, Cleveland, TN 37311
OPEN NOW:8:00 am - 5:00 pm
From Business: A privately held company in Cleveland, TN.
41 Years
in Business
Showing 31-31 of 31
- 1
- 2
1402 Jones Ave SW, Cleveland, TN 37311
From Business: A privately held company in Cleveland, TN.
Showing 31-31 of 31